The garage occupancy feed for the Brindlewood campus arrives over a message queue every thirty seconds, one record per level, published by the Stallgrid edge boxes. Counts can briefly go negative when a sensor double-fires on exit; the ingest job clamps these to zero and flags the interval. If the feed stalls for more than five minutes, the dashboard falls back to the last known snapshot. Sensor mappings, queue names, and the replay procedure are documented on the internal page below.

runbook for tahog-kadug: https://gitlab.qirvanworks.corp/projects/pages/view/b139298aed28

Re: Retirement of the Stonebriar product line

Stonebriar sales have declined for five consecutive quarters and support costs now exceed contribution margin. The retirement plan is staged: new orders close end of Q2, existing contracts honoured through their terms, and spares stocked for twenty-four months. Sales leads should steer prospects toward the Ashgrove range; migration incentives are already approved. Customer comms are drafted and awaiting legal sign-off. The forward strategy behind this decision is set out in the note below.

confidential, yafog-hagug: Gross margin on Druix came in at 10 percent against a plan of 15 percent. Only 5 of the 80 pilot accounts renewed Druix, so a churn review is set for October 1.

# Loyalty-points ledger for the Pinwheel rewards program.
# Heads up for the sync: we moved the ledger to append-only mode, so
# corrections are now compensating entries, not updates. Nightly
# balance snapshots run at 02:00 and flag any drift over 5 points.
# The snapshot job uses the database set on the next line.

replica DSN, yahaf-yagaf: mongodb://tamath_svc:a2netSk3RZMuTj@db-d084.novacsoft.internal:5432/ralmir

Ticket: Gaugewick sidecar double-counts counters after restart

So the metrics-aggregation sidecar on the Pinefold cluster replays its buffer on restart but doesn't dedupe, which means every crash-loop inflates counters by roughly 2x. Ops noticed when the checkout dashboard showed impossible spikes. Proposed fix: persist a high-water mark per stream and skip anything already flushed. Patch is ready and passed the soak test overnight — just needs your sign-off before the cut. Verified fix is in the build noted below.

pipeline stamp: htk9_6ce9d33c5